Outline of Final Research Achievements |
In this study, we tried to make imaging observation of acoustic waves in the upper atmosphere through OH airglow. Although we could not detect any acoustic-wave signatures in the airglow images obtained during special campaigns in 2016, this study offers valuable insights into the acoustic waves in the upper atmosphere: acoustic waves would induce small (less than 3%) airglow intensity perturbations and/or would be even less likely to propagate into the upper atmosphere compared to gravity waves. Additionally, the low-cost airglow camera developed in this study will greatly help an expansion in ground-based airglow imaging network.
